Rotate

The Rotate function allows you to change the orientation of a saved
photo.
To rotate an image:
1. Press the MENU button to select ROTATE from the menu.
2. Press the OK button to enter the edit mode.
3. Press the Left/Right navigation buttons to rotate the selected
image.
4. Press the Up/Down navigation buttons and the OK button to
confirm or cancel the rotation.
• OK: Confirm selection and save image.
: Select to discard the changes and return to the main
menu.

Protect

You can lock a photo or video to protect it from being accidentally erased.
To lock a photo or video:
1. Press the MENU button to select PROTECT from the menu and press the OK button to enter.
2. Use the Up/Down navigation buttons to select Lock
confirm the one you needed.
3. A key
icon displays at the top of the screen to indicate the photo/video is now locked.
4. To unlock a photo or video, perform the steps 1 and 2 again.
